Mulch Mound Pro Tip

Reading pesticide labels completely before any application protects Brock Hall gardens from unintended consequences and wasted product. Specific products affect more than just target pests, application rates matter precisely for effectiveness and safety, and timing restrictions exist for good reasons. More product is never better.

Mulch Mound Pro Tip

Brock Hall gardens built on red clay benefit tremendously from regular compost applications. Unlike synthetic fertilizers that feed plants directly, bulk compost feeds the soil food web,bacteria, fungi, and earthworms that gradually transform dense clay into friable, moisture-retentive growing medium. Top-dress beds with 1 to 2 inches of finished compost each fall, allowing Brock Hall's 44 inches of annual rainfall to work organic matter down through the clay profile over winter and into early spring.

Mulch Mound Pro Tip

Replacing high-maintenance turf areas in Brock Hall with native plant groupings reduces inputs and supports local pollinators. Maryland natives like black-eyed Susan, switchgrass, and buttonbush are adapted to Zone 7b winters, clay soils, and seasonal rainfall patterns without supplemental care. Mulch between plantings with 2 to 3 inches of shredded hardwood to prevent weed establishment while plants fill in. Once established after one full growing season, these plantings need minimal intervention compared to traditional Brock Hall lawn areas.

How do I choose between hardwood mulch and wood chips for my Brock Hall garden beds?

Hardwood mulch is the better choice for Brock Hall ornamental beds,it's finer textured, looks polished, and decomposes at a rate that improves clay soil without depleting nitrogen. Wood chips work better as a pathway material or around large established trees. For new plantings in Brock Hall's clay soil, shredded hardwood gives the best balance of aesthetics and soil-building function.

Should I amend Brock Hall's soil before planting a new shrub border?

Yes,Brock Hall's red clay should be amended before installing a shrub border. Excavate the planting area and blend bulk compost into native soil at a 30-to-40-percent ratio by volume. This improves drainage and root penetration without creating a container effect where roots refuse to expand beyond the amended zone. Mulch immediately after planting to retain moisture.

How deep should I lay river rock for a Brock Hall dry creek bed?

For a functional dry creek bed in Brock Hall, lay river rock 4 to 6 inches deep in the channel and 2 to 3 inches deep on the banks. Install heavy-duty landscape fabric beneath to prevent rock from sinking into clay over time. Size the channel to handle peak drainage volume,Brock Hall's 44 inches of annual rain generates significant flow during intense summer storms.
